Summary:
In Episode 6, Molly and I sit down with Sarah for part 2 of our inspiring conversation. Sarah reflects on her journey emphasizing the importance of following one's passion and being open to new opportunities. She shares the verse Ephesians 2:10 relieved her pressure to choose a specific path and allowed her journey to unfold naturally. Sarah encourages listeners to walk with the Lord, pursue their dreams, and not limit themselves, even if their journey takes unexpected turns. The discussion also touches on the song "King of My Heart. " We know Sarah will inspire a deeper union with Christ through this vulnerable interview.

most holy moment-
“When my parents got divorced it felt like someone had died. It was the hardest thing I had ever gone through at the time. It shook my identity. I had just had my first baby. I wondered what was even true anymore. I was processing with the Lord and the chorus to King of My Heart was my response.”
on suffering-
“I have lived with chronic pain for more than 10 years. I want to share because I know a lot of people are struggling with this. It keeps you needy and soft, and compassionate. It keeps me softer to the Lord and needy for Him. It’s hard because daily it works on my mind and messes with my personality. But there is no guarantee for a life without struggle. My favorite aspect of Jesus is that He walks with us in it. It doesn’t make our lives perfect. But he is in it. I feel that.”
a thought to end with-
God is with us in the painful journeys- not watching from the sidelines. It is part of the holiness in our lives. It can be a gift.
